Downloading and installing the Google Play Store on Android 4.2.2 (Jelly Bean) is a common way to revive older devices, though it requires specific versions to ensure compatibility. Since this version of Android is no longer officially supported for the newest Play Store updates, you must manually install a compatible "legacy" version. 1. Enable Installation from Unknown Sources
By default, Android blocks apps downloaded from outside the official store.
Go to Settings > Security (or Applications on some older devices). Check the box next to Unknown Sources. Confirm the warning message by tapping OK. 2. Download the Correct APK Version
For Android 4.2.2, you cannot use the latest version of the Play Store. You must find a version designed for "Android 4.1+" or "Android 4.0+".
Safe Sources: Use reputable sites like APKMirror or Uptodown to avoid malware.
Compatible Versions: Look for versions from around 2018 or earlier (such as Google Play Store 12.2.12), as these are often the last stable builds for Jelly Bean.
Google Play Services: You may also need to download a compatible Google Play Services APK (e.g., version 4.2.42) for the store to function correctly. 3. Install the APK Open your File Manager or Downloads app. Locate the downloaded .apk file. Tap the file and select Install.
Once finished, tap Open or find the Play Store icon in your app drawer. 4. Troubleshooting "No Connection" or Server Errors
If the store opens but won't connect, it is often due to outdated security protocols (TLS 1.2).
Restoring or updating the Google Play Store on a device running Android 4.2.2 (Jelly Bean) can feel like a bit of digital archaeology, but it is entirely possible with the right APK. While this version of Android is no longer supported by modern Google Play Services updates as of mid-2021, you can still manually sideload compatible versions to keep your legacy device functional. Finding the Right Version
For Android 4.2.2, you cannot simply download the "latest" version of the Play Store meant for Android 13 or 14, as these will crash immediately.
Target API: You need an APK designed for Android 4.1+ (API 16).
Version Compatibility: Historical archives like APKMirror host specific "all" or "nodpi" variants of the Play Store (such as version 15.x or 24.x) that were some of the last to officially support Jelly Bean.
Core Dependencies: The Play Store is the "heart" of the OS but it won't beat without Google Play Services. If you are installing the Store from scratch, you must also download and install a compatible version of Play Services (often version 9.4.52 or 15.x for ARMv7 devices).
